With each passing week it seems we bring you news of a new housing development planned for our district.

It is well documented our towns and villages are at the mercy of developers because there is no approved Local Plan in place.

This has seen a large number of new homes approved in recent years and led to growing frustration among both residents and councillors.

David Mann is the latest to raise serious concerns about the impact building these new houses will have on our roads during the meeting where 825 homes were approved in Panfield Lane.

It is obvious for all to see congestion will only get worse until infrastructure is seriously looked at.

While new homes may be needed, their benefits will surely be redundant if our road network is not improved as well.
